The immune system responds to antigens by producing cells that directly attack the pathogen, or by producing special proteins called antibodies. Antibodies attach to an antigen and attract cells that will engulf and destroy the pathogen.
How does the immune system remove pathogens?
The B lymphocytes (or B-cells) create antibodies and alert the T lymphocytes (or T-cells) to kill the pathogens. White blood cells are a part of the lymphatic system, a network of lymph vessels that collect excess fluids from tissues throughout the body and then return them to your bloodstream.

What happens when pathogen enters the body?
After a pathogen enters the body, infected cells are identified and destroyed by natural killer (NK) cells, which are a type of lymphocyte that can kill cells infected with viruses or tumor cells (abnormal cells that uncontrollably divide and invade other tissue).
What cells destroy pathogens?
Macrophages and neutrophils (phagocytes) are the front-line defenders in your body’s immune system. They seek out, ingest, and destroy pathogens and other debris through a process called phagocytosis.

What are the immune cells that participates in human immunity?
The cells of the immune system can be categorized as lymphocytes (T-cells, B-cells and NK cells), neutrophils, and monocytes/macrophages. These are all types of white blood cells. The major proteins of the immune system are predominantly signaling proteins (often called cytokines), antibodies, and complement proteins.

How does the immune system differentiate a pathogen from body cells?
Pathogens have molecules called antigens on their surface. Antigens provide a unique signature for the pathogen that enables immune system cells to recognize different pathogens and distinguish pathogens from the body’s own cells and tissues. How do antibodies Neutralise toxins?
By binding specifically to surface structures (antigen) on an infectious particle, neutralizing antibodies prevent the particle from interacting with its host cells it might infect and destroy.
What involves mainly T cells and leads to the destruction of cells that are infected with viruses?
Cell-Mediated Immune Response. In addition to the humoral response, the other type of immune response is the cell-mediated immune response, which involves mainly T cells. It leads to the destruction of cells that are infected with viruses. Some cancer cells are also destroyed in this way.
How do cytotoxic T cells fight off pathogens?
Once a cell is infected, there is no way for antibodies to destroy the infection – this is where cytotoxic T cells come in. Through the process of selection, these cells attach to antigen-bonding receptors which then allows them to monitor and destroy cells that pose a threat to the body.

Does gender affect immune system?
Generally, adult females mount stronger innate and adaptive immune responses than males. This results in faster clearance of pathogens and greater vaccine efficacy in females than in males but also contributes to their increased susceptibility to inflammatory and autoimmune diseases.

How does the immune system defend against pathogens GCSE?
Phagocytes surround any pathogens in the blood and engulf them. They are attracted to pathogens and bind to them. The phagocytes membrane surrounds the pathogen and enzymes found inside the cell break down the pathogen in order to destroy it.
